The Enduring Power of the Spoken (and Written) Word
Poetry has always been a weapon of the oppressed and a balm for the broken. From the protest songs of the 1960s to the powerful verses that emerged from the gulags, words have a unique ability to capture the human experience, to give voice to the voiceless, and to rally communities around shared causes. It’s about more than just rhyme and meter; it’s about resonance, about finding the words that make us feel seen, heard, and understood.
A New Stage: Digital Platforms and Global Reach
The internet, social media, and various digital platforms have transformed this ancient art form. They’ve given poetry a new stage, one that’s global, instantaneous, and incredibly democratic.
Think about it:
- Amplified Voices: A poem written in a small village in Ukraine can now reach audiences in Africa, Asia, and the Americas with just a click. Platforms like Instagram, Twitter, and even dedicated poetry sites have become hubs for sharing work that tackles social issues head-on. Movements like blacklivesmatter, metoo, and countless others have found expression and solidarity through shared poetic narratives.
- Community Building: Online forums, Facebook groups, and even specialized apps allow poets from diverse backgrounds to connect, collaborate, and support each other. This global community can provide validation, encouragement, and a sense of belonging that transcends geographical boundaries.
- Instant Impact: A powerful poem can go viral, sparking conversations and driving social awareness in real-time. It can challenge misinformation, advocate for policy change, and mobilize people for action faster than ever before.

Poetry as Medicine for the Soul (and the Society)
The therapeutic power of poetry is well-documented. Writing can be a cathartic release, a way to process trauma, grief, and anxiety. But its healing potential extends beyond the individual.
- Collective Healing: In communities ravaged by conflict, displacement, or systemic injustice, poetry can be a crucial tool for collective healing. It allows people to share their collective narrative, to mourn losses together, and to envision a shared future. Think about the role of poetry in post-apartheid South Africa, or in countries rebuilding after civil war.
- Building Resilience: By giving voice to pain and struggle, poetry can help communities build resilience. It can help us make sense of the senseless, find meaning in tragedy, and cultivate hope in the darkest times.
